About The Position

The Beverage & Food Attendant is responsible for administering the basic day-to-day Beverage & Food service duties. The Beverage & Food Team is also responsible for maintaining the cleanliness of the venue throughout the shift.

Requirements

  • Proficient in English.
  • Basic mathematic skills are required.
  • Ability to lift up to 50lbs

Nice To Haves

  • High School Diploma or Equivalent preferred.
  • Beverage and food experience is preferred.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.

Responsibilities

  • Take orders and serve customers using the point-of-sales system.
  • Ensure coffee stations and bar area, including beverage coolers and snacks, are stocked properly and consistently throughout the shift.
  • Receive orders and serve customer requests completely in a timely manner, including but not limited to serving as a barista.
  • Understand menu content, any menu changes, and promotional activities.
  • Keep your service area clean, tidy, and well-prepared.
  • Ensure collection and recording receipt of appropriate payment (cash, credit card transactions); Handle and record cash and credit card transactions in accordance with company and City procedures.
  • Answer Guest queries in a polite and helpful manner.
  • Maintain a working knowledge of beverages and food offered and how to prepare and serve them.
  • Provide assistance with setting up and breaking down food and beverage stations.
  • Setting up workstations as needed.
  • Serving water to guests and refilling beverage glasses as needed.
  • Placing and replacing silverware as needed.
  • Delivering beverages from the bartender.
  • Delivering food from the kitchen.
  • Stocking wait staff serving stations with napkins, utensils, trays, condiments, and salt and pepper containers.
  • Directing guests to restrooms or exits as needed.
  • Clearing tables and conference rooms throughout the venue as guests complete their meals /beverages and preparing tables for the next guests.
  • Following and maintaining all sanitation and safety procedures and required training.
  • Touch-up vacuum as necessary.
  • Assists in cleaning, running dishwashers, restocking barware and other operational supplies, opening/closing tasks, and other duties as needed.
  • Heat up and service food items. Assist in preparing salads, appetizers, entrée, or desserts, plating and adding garnishes to food.
  • Perform other duties as assigned or required by managers.
  • Maintain kitchen cleanness, including floors, floor mats of all outlets, and dish pit.
  • Trash removal to a designated location.
  • Event Space set up and refresh, including setting up of meeting tables and chairs and Beverage & Food stations when business demands.
